A nice portrait of a very over looked subject. Details look nice, beautiful water and the water drops on the beak and the water add a bunch. Looks very good for ISO 3200. That d500 is really an excellent camera. Overall the colors look thin and the image is too bright. Image needs to be warmed up and I would crop differently. The files in flat light really need to be pushed to make them come to life.

I did the following.

In levels I lowered the black point by 7 and the mid tones by 10
I selected the bird and upped the saturation of the reds by 20 to bring more out of the red chest
I lowered the brightness -5
In Viveza I upped the warmth of the image +20
Ran a Detail extractor/tonal contrast layer at 10% opacity to bring out more details in the bird
Ran NR on background
Also I do not think the reflection added anything to the image so I lowered the bird in the frame and added canvas to get more of that beautiful warm water above. Really you could have left a little more of the reflection but I wanted to get rid of those 2 big white spots in the water so cropped to there to make it easy. Again this is not perfect when working on these tiny compressed files but it is a step in the direction the file should go.
